In the heart of a modern world, where the rhythm of nature often seems lost, poet Kinsale Drake invites us on a journey to reconnection in her poem "In Diné Tradition."

The speaker recalls a memory from their childhood, when their mother would rise with the sun, following a tradition deeply rooted in Diné culture. Each dawn, she would go out to greet the sun, performing a blessing with her palms, her calm movements gently waking the speaker.

However, as the speaker grew older, they found themselves drawn away from this connection with nature. A journey to cities, possibly driven by false light and syncopation, led to a sense of disconnection from the natural world.

In the poem, the speaker expresses a longing to find the song they lost, a song that once resonated with the rhythm of the sun. They ask for forgiveness, not only for falling out of step with the sun's rhythm but also for forgetting their own tongue.

The poem paints a vivid picture of this disconnection, with images of anger in the eyes, a feeling of being pulled at the tide in the chest, and imaginary reprimands from jays in the brambles and the cheii in the prickly pear.

Yet, there is a glimmer of hope. As the speaker creeps towards the threshold of home, following a sliver of horizon, they find the sky splintering into light. Even in the mid-afternoon heat, there is a light that seems to call them back to their roots.
